Output 8b13f6f8897a8d0465fa212466a1b4bb94cfafa65c12cd25f89e5e08703faf2e:0

value
15407171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830da43d00c7e3e1eb9e8baa1d785fcdc79955ba OP_EQUAL
address
3DdxnWGbvZtdAddntXrKEmEkL6FqoL3emP
transaction
8b13f6f8897a8d0465fa212466a1b4bb94cfafa65c12cd25f89e5e08703faf2e
confirmations
341783
spent
true